Training how to leverage parallel bio-reactors

In May, we had a training on how to leverage parallel bio-reactors. Ramcon’s two experts, Kenneth Rasmussen and Ida Järbur came to Testa Center and gave a training session on the Lucullus software (from Securecell). The software is used to program and control our Applikon Ez-2 parallel bio-reactors, but can be used for a wide range of products in Life Science.

Parallel bio-reactors are handy when you need like to run experimental processes with controlled variability, or scaling out to more production units. Running parallel bio-reactors can be confusing as there will be many different sets of variables to keep track of. And sometimes in systems that do not communicate in between each other. The promise of Lucullus is to solve this issue for us.

Upgrading from BioExpert to Lucullus now helps the any application specialist to adjust, program and run the bio-reactors. The software collects the real-time data and helps you to evaluate and store it in a modern way.
